  1. Stanbridge Earls School was a coeducational independent special school located near Romsey, Hampshire, England. Students ranged in age from 10–19. The school catered for both boarding and day pupils. The school specialized in teaching and helping pupils with dyslexia, dyscalculia, developmental coordination disorder and mild ...

  2. Stanbridge Earls School in Hampshire has a vast history. The main house in Audley Stanbridge Earls is a Grade II* listed building . [3] Its history dates back to Saxon royalty, with links to King Alfred the Great and the founder of modern nursing, Florence Nightingale .

  3. Summary. Claimed since Saxon times that King Ethelwulf, father of King Alfred, died at Stanbridge Earls. The manor was held by a number of families until, by the early nineteenth century it was in a ruinous state.
